Heitkamp’s Embrace Of Illegal Immigrants Hit By Trump-Aligned Group

North Dakota Democratic Sen. Heidi Heitkamp is coming under fire for her support of “dreamers” and sanctuary cities, this time in a $980,000 campaign from the Trump-aligned group America First Action.

The effort from the outside group that is working to keep Republicans in control of the Senate and win President Trump reelection in 2020 features a new ad Tuesday that ties Heitkamp to liberals embracing amnesty for illegal immigrants and the abolition of Immigration and Customs Enforcement. 

The new ad plays off a direct mail campaign recently sent to voters in the state. “Again and again, Heitkamp sided with Washington liberals,” said the latest pamphlet that pictured the senator with House Minority Leader Nancy Pelosi.

The ad, meanwhile, includes images of Sens. Bernie Sanders, Elizabeth Warren and Kirsten Gillibrand, called leaders of the liberal amnesty movement.

“When it comes to Heidi Heitkamp, we don’t know whose side she’s on,” said the new ad.

It is set to appear on these North Dakota stations: KVLY, KVRR, KXJB, WDAY, KBMY, KFYR, KNDX, and KXMC. On cable, it will air locally on CNN, Discovery, ESPN, Fox News, HGTV, MSNBC, History Channel, TBS, USA, Hallmark, and TNT.

America First Action said, “Not only has Sen.Heitkamp criticized President Trump's plan to build a wall along the southern border, but she has voted repeatedly to protect dangerous sanctuary cities. She also voted for amnesty for 11 million illegal immigrants, including criminals who committed serious crimes like domestic violence, aggravated assault, child abuse, and drunk driving. It is imperative that North Dakotans cast their vote for Kevin Cramer for Senate on Election Day.”

Challenger Rep. Kevin Cramer, has also targeted Heitkamp’s support for illegal immigrants, and has an ad that includes Trump hitting Heitkamp on immigration issues. 

“I voted against funding sanctuary cities because federal tax dollars shouldn’t go to cities that hide illegal immigrants, especially those who commit violent crimes,” Cramer said in his own ad. “It’s hard to understand why Heidi Heitkamp, who is a former attorney general, voted to fund sanctuary cities that ignore the rule of law and put our citizens and law-enforcement officers at risk.”
